Output 83d69a54ef0e4ca5f54dc2b5d09a97785a6885272f9b3470509d22086935edd6:1

value
2679141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7588ab9b7f33be78a8b4016679a84eae5de50e94 OP_EQUAL
address
3CQUi1Wvkz13yqur3WQvB4Fj3zZbZXzHsp
transaction
83d69a54ef0e4ca5f54dc2b5d09a97785a6885272f9b3470509d22086935edd6
confirmations
294896
spent
true